Steps to make Oats fruits, sprouts, roasted veggies,cheese omelette:
  1. In a glass add ¼ cup of oats, 2tbsp curd,fruits. Repeat the layer again with the remaining ingredients.
  2. Mix chanasprouts with salt, chopped ginger and chopped coconut and place them in katori.
  3. Roast mushrooms, bell peppers and asparagus with butter and salt. Boil macaroni. Mix them properly and place them in katori.
  4. Add milk, mozerrala cheese, salt and coriander leaves. Whisk them properly to make cheese omelette.
  5. Mix all-purpose flour, salt, oil and warm water. Knead them to make a dough. Roll it out with a roller pin.
  6. Take a katori. Use it as a frame. Apply oil in and around it and place the roti over the katori. Pierce it with a fork. Fry it in oil.
